Abstract

Objectives To demonstrate a laparoscopic stepwise approach to a paraortic lymphdenectomy based on anatomical landmarks.

Methods and interventions Complete endometrial cancer laparoscopic staging including hysterectomy, bilateral salpingooforectomy, omentectomy, pelvic and paraortic lymphdenectomy. Procedure was performed based on classical anatomical landmarks which were highlighted in post video production.

Results Safe stepwise complete endometrial cancer laparoscopic staging including hysterectomy, bilateral salpingooforectomy, omentectomy, pelvic and paraortic lymphdenectomy. Procedure was performed based on classical anatomical landmarks which were highlighted in post video production.

Conclusions Laparoscopic paraortic lymphdenectomy is a complex procedure fraught with dangers. A stepwise approach allows for a clean, secure and complete procedure with diminished risks for the patient. We believe that a stepwise approach associated to highlighted landmarks improve teaching and education in surgical procedures.
